Used Scissor Lift Fullerton - Scissor lifts are industrial machines that rely on a configuration of crisscrossed linked steel arms. This equipment is utilized to create an “X” patterned support in order to accomplish vertical lifting. There is a rectangular platform that is attached to the top of the scissor lift. There are secure support railings along the platform edge for extra safety and to keep the operator safe. The scissor lift showcases a low profile that is excellent for compact, hard surfaces including pavement and concrete. Scissor lifts can use an electric motor or a combustion engine to transport and lift the machine. The scissor lift operates on a vertical plane and if the operator needs to move the lift horizontally, they have to reposition the machine. The same lifting technology is used for the lifting components in regular scissor lift models as well as rough terrain models. Rough terrain scissor lifts are adapted for travelling on uneven locations. These machines rely on large all-terrain tires to allow rough terrain scissor lifts to traverse difficult locations while offering higher ground clearance. These scissor lifts feature 4WD to get through muddy and difficult terrain. Lower lifting heights are offered due to the higher center of gravity. Scissor lifts can seem intimidating if you have not used one before. While you may think this machine is susceptible to swaying in the wind or becoming unbalanced, understand that it has been designed to ensure total operator safety and that likely, you will not even feel the machine moving. Numerous safety tests need to be completed prior to being capable of being sold. It is natural to feel uncomfortable if you are new to this type of equipment. Safety precautions need to be maintained at all times. Understanding what you will be using your scissor lift for will help ensure you have the right type of model. The unit you need will vastly depend on the kind of work you need to do. How high you need to travel and how heavy the loads you will be transporting are all key factors. There are different models on the market that can help you reach various heights. Tinier models are often preferred for interior jobs such as factory, freight or warehousing situations. There is no reason to buy the biggest and best model on the market if you are not going to use the highest capacity. Electric scissor lifts have optional platforms and railings to offer maximum safety features. These units are safe and reliable. Many safety inspections and specifications need to be maintained in order for these industrial machines to be available for sale. Scissor lifts help people accomplish tasks that are otherwise unattainable, unreachable or inaccessible. These lifts elevate vertically; therefore, the machine is parked in place prior to lifting. Before the lift is engaged, the operator will properly position the unit. Numerous safety features have been designed into the machine. Safety is accomplished by following operational guidelines. The scissor lift’s safety basket creates a secure work area compared to trying to accomplish similar tasks from a ladder or scaffolding. The majority of scissor lifts utilize batteries that are internally mounted inside of the base of the lift to generate power. Electric scissor lifts need to be charged regularly; especially after prolonged work shifts. Numerous operators charge their units throughout the day or replace batteries every 12 hours. To facilitate scissor lift charging, the operator can park the machine close to an electrical outlet in a well-ventilated place. The emergency shut-off switch is engaged upon parking to prevent other operators from driving off while plugged in. The sizeable red button found inside of the basket or the lift located near the charger or control box is the emergency shut-off switch. Oftentimes, the battery charger is found on the right side of the lift on the base of the machine. Older scissor lifts may have a battery charger found on the back of the unit. The charger for the machine is plugged into the AC extension cord within a well-ventilated area and the extension cord plugs into an electrical outlet. The electrical cord length on the battery charger has to be short for safety reasons to prevent the unit from running over it. There is a high possibility of danger if the extension cord dropped out of the battery charger while the machine is in operation. Once the scissor lift is plugged in, all of the lights on the charger should ideally become illuminated. The batteries will automatically begin charging once plugged in. After the charging is complete, the battery lights switch to green and the charger shuts down. Older scissor lift models rely on a meter to show whether zero volts have been attained after complete charging has occurred. This type of charger automatically shuts down as well once charging is done. After the batteries are completely charged the scissor lift can complete another shift. It is common for warehouses and businesses to have numerous batteries continually charging to keep the scissor lift operating 24 hours a day. Scissor Lift PDF
